With the
aim of increasing women’s active citizenship and access to
social entitlements (namely, healthcare, education, welfare),
the ACGEN project
seeks to
place the issue of active citizenship and gendered social
entitlements on the agenda of NGOs/CSOs as well as state
institutions. This will be done through a comprehensive capacity
building programme for NGOs and an advocacy effort aimed at
promoting women’s active citizenship in three countries of the
region.
Within this
context, CRTD.A is
in the process of launching in Lebanon a complementary outreach
project over a period of six months. The project is envisaged
as a key tool for information sharing and dissemination, for
communication and for lobbying and advocacy work aiming at
raising awareness on Social Entitlements and Basic Rights as
well as at inducing policy dialogue.
